Stefanie Zadravec perceptively explores the crushing consequences of a war in this unconventional kitchen-sink drama, set in a pair of cramped Bosnian kitchens in 1992. The styles of the two halves of Erica Schmidt's production seem at war themselves; with the first act pitched at a very high volume and the second more understated; the full force of Zadravec’s skill emerges in its more subtler moments.—Diane Snyder
